Venari Minerals Secures Vital Water Rights to De-risk Red Mountain Lithium Project

Venari Minerals has taken a strategic step to de-risk its Red Mountain Lithium Project by securing private water rights and land in Nevada, a critical resource in the arid region. This move, alongside ongoing metallurgical testwork and an upcoming resource estimate, positions the project for advancement.

Venari Minerals Confirms Broad Lithium Zones at Red Mountain Ahead of Maiden Resource

Venari Minerals has reported strong lithium assay results from its October drilling campaign at the Red Mountain Project in Nevada, completing the central zone dataset ahead of a maiden Mineral Resource Estimate expected next month.

Venari Minerals Uncovers Six Untested Soil Anomalies at Nevada’s Needles Project

Venari Minerals has identified six strong multi-element soil anomalies at its Needles Gold Project in Nevada, highlighting significant untested potential for large-scale epithermal gold-silver mineralisation. The company awaits assay results from recent drilling amid a US lab backlog.

Venari Minerals Boosts Lithium Grades by Up to 132% at Red Mountain

Venari Minerals reports a breakthrough in lithium upgrading at its Red Mountain Project, achieving up to a 132% increase in lithium concentration through innovative attrition scrubbing test-work. This advancement paves the way for a maiden Mineral Resource Estimate by year-end.
